DHL to enter Argentina logistics segment

DHL, the Argentinian filial of the German group and one of four firms operating international mail systems in Argentina (along with Holland’s TNT and the US pair FedEx and UPS), is now to enter the logistics sector in Argentina. The national filial will post a turnover of US$40mil in 2006 – up by 20% on 2005 – and will focus on the door-to-door solutions niche: it hopes to attain a 20percent share of the segment in two years, the segment moving USD50mil annually overall. The firm will invest USD2mil in starting up in this area nationally and USD1.7mil in the international implications.

DHL ranks top of the courier exports charts with 50percent of the pie (in terms of kilos carried). It employs 527 people in Argentina.
